British car industry braces for 2025 dip
Britain’s new vehicle production is expected to decline by 15 per cent in 2025, weighed down by global trade disruption; however, a reversal is expected the next year, industry data showed on Thursday.
While global automakers continue to feel the impact of US President Donald Trump’s tariffs, the UK is set to benefit from a new trade deal that slashed taxes on British car exports.
